2025 Women's Lacrosse Roster

Jersey Number 15
Maya Rutherford
- Class:
- Senior
- Position:
- D
- Height:
- 6-0
- Hometown:
- Denver, Colo.
- High School:
- Colorado Academy
At Michigan
• Broke the Michigan career games played and career games started record (78) as she played in and started every game of her collegiate career
• Was a member of the 2025 New Zealand National Team
• Three-time Academic All-Big Ten (2023, 2024, 2025)
• IWLCA Academic Honor Roll (2024)
• Two-time Big Ten Distinguished Scholar (2023, 2025)
Senior (2025)
• Broke the Michigan career games played and career games started record (78) as she played in and started every game of her collegiate career
• Big Ten Distinguished Scholar
• Academic All-Big Ten
• Appeared in and started all 20 games
• Helped anchor a defense that ranked eighth nationally in scoring defense giving up just 9.05 goals per game
• Picked up 21 ground balls and had 13 caused turnovers
• Had two ground balls and two caused turnovers against Penn (March 1)
Junior (2024)
• Academic All-Big Ten
• IWLCA Academic Honor Roll
• Appeared in and started all 20 games
• Was part of a Michigan defense that ranked No. 1 nationally in scoring defense for the entire 2024 season
• Picked up 14 ground balls
• Ranked fourth on the team with 15 caused turnovers
Sophomore (2023)
• Big Ten Distinguished Scholar
• Started all 20 games on defense for Michigan
• Picked up 11 ground balls
• Caused six turnovers
• Notched a season-best four ground balls against No. 1 Northwestern in the NCAA Tournament
Freshman (2022)
• Started all 18 games on the Michigan defense
• Helped the U-M defense to a No. 9 national ranking in scoring defense allowing just 9.28 goals per game
• Picked up seven ground balls
• Had four caused turnovers
• Added three draw control wins
• Picked up two ground balls at Rutgers
Prep
• Prepped at Colorado Academy where she was a three-year starter with her junior season being cancelled due to the Covid-19 pandemic
• Was a 2021 USA Lacrosse All-American and Adrenaline All-America selection
• Named first team all-state as a senior
• Helped her team to three state championship and was undefeated in her entire high school lacrosse career
• Named a team captain in her senior season
Club
• Played club lacrosse for Summit Elite 2021, which was ranked as high as No. 9 in the country, with teammate Katharine Merrifield
• Was a 2021 Adrenaline All-American and was named to the UA All-America West Regional All-Star team
• Named to the 2021 Under Armour All-American watch list
Other Sports
• Lettered in field hockey where she helped her team to a 2020 state championship
• Named honorable mention all-state as a senior
• Played AA club ice hockey where she helped the team to two state championships
• Served as co-captain of the team in 2021
Personal
• Full name is Maya Jane Rutherford
• Daughter of Matt and JJ Rutherford
• Father, Matt, was a member of the Princeton crew team
• Mother, JJ, was a member of the Princeton women's lacrosse team and helped the team to the 1994 national championship
• Enrolled in the College of Literature, Science, and the Arts
• Majoring in Computer Science
